Should You Buy a 1998 Kawasaki Voyager XII?
The 1998 Kawasaki Voyager XII is a touring motorcycle that combines comfort and performance for long-distance rides. With a powerful 1.196L engine producing 97 hp and 80 lb-ft of torque, it offers a satisfying ride for those who enjoy the open road. The bike achieves an impressive 45.1 MPG combined, making it a practical choice for extended journeys. Although specific details regarding MSRP, drive type, and transmission are not available, the Voyager XII is known for its reliability and smooth handling, making it a popular choice among touring enthusiasts.
The 1998 Kawasaki Voyager XII is best suited for experienced riders who enjoy long-distance touring and prioritize comfort and reliability over cutting-edge technology.
